The role of rostral prefrontal cortex in prospective memory: a voxel-based lesion study.

Abstract

Patients with lesions in rostral prefrontal cortex (PFC) often experience problems in everyday-life situations requiring multitasking. A key cognitive component that is critical in multitasking situations is prospective memory, defined as the ability to carry out an intended action after a delay period filled with unrelated activity. The few functional imaging studies investigating prospective memory have shown consistent activation in both medial and lateral rostral PFC but also in more posterior prefrontal regions and non-frontal regions. The aim of this study was to determine regions that are necessary for prospective memory performance, using the human lesion approach. We designed an experimental paradigm allowing us to assess time-based (remembering to do something at a particular time) and event-based (remembering to do something in a particular situation) prospective memory, using two types of material, words and pictures. Time estimation tasks and tasks controlling for basic attention, inhibition and multiple instructions processing were also administered. We examined brain-behaviour relationships with a voxelwise lesion method in 45 patients with focal brain lesions and 107 control subjects using this paradigm. The results showed that lesions in the right polar prefrontal region (in Brodmann area 10) were specifically associated with a deficit in time-based prospective memory tasks for both words and pictures. This deficit could not be explained by impairments in basic attention, detection, inhibition or multiple instruction processing, and there was also no deficit in event-based prospective memory conditions. In addition to their prospective memory difficulties, these polar prefrontal patients were significantly impaired in time estimation ability compared to other patients. The same region was found to be involved using both words and pictures, suggesting that right rostral PFC plays a material nonspecific role in prospective memory. This is the first lesion study showing that rostral PFC is crucial for time-based prospective memory. The findings suggest that time-based and event-based prospective memory might be supported at least in part by distinct brain regions. Two particularly plausible explanations for the deficit rest upon a possible role for polar prefrontal structures in supporting in time estimation, and/or in retrieving an intention to act. More broadly, the results are consistent with the view that the deficit of rostral patients in multitasking situations might at least in part be explained by a deficit in prospective memory.

摘要

前额皮质(PFC)损伤的患者在日常生活中经常遇到需要多任务处理的问题。多任务处理情境下的关键认知成分是前瞻性记忆,即延迟一段时间后仍能执行预先计划的行为的能力。少数功能影像学研究表明,内侧和外侧额前皮质以及更靠后的前额皮质和非前额皮质区域都与前瞻性记忆有关。本研究旨在采用人类脑损伤方法确定进行前瞻性记忆所需的脑区。我们设计了一个实验范式,允许我们使用两种材料(单词和图片)评估基于时间(在特定时间记住要做某事)和基于事件(在特定情况下记住要做某事)的前瞻性记忆。我们还进行了时间估计任务以及控制基本注意、抑制和多重指令处理的任务。我们使用该范式,对 45 名患有局灶性脑损伤的患者和 107 名对照者进行了基于体素的脑损伤方法,以检查大脑与行为之间的关系。结果表明,右侧极额前皮质(Brodmann 区 10)的损伤与基于时间的单词和图片前瞻性记忆任务缺陷有关。这种缺陷不能用基本注意、检测、抑制或多重指令处理的损伤来解释,基于事件的前瞻性记忆条件也没有缺陷。除了前瞻性记忆困难外,这些极额前皮质患者在时间估计能力方面明显受损,与其他患者相比。与其他患者相比,使用单词和图片均发现同一区域受损,表明右侧额前皮质在前瞻性记忆中发挥了材料非特异性作用。这是第一个表明额前皮质对基于时间的前瞻性记忆至关重要的脑损伤研究。这些发现表明,基于时间的和基于事件的前瞻性记忆可能至少部分由不同的脑区支持。对于这种缺陷,有两种特别合理的解释,一种可能是极额前皮质结构在支持时间估计方面发挥作用,另一种可能是在检索执行意图方面发挥作用。更广泛地说,这些结果与以下观点一致,即前额皮质损伤患者在多任务处理情境下的缺陷至少部分可以用前瞻性记忆缺陷来解释。
